研究興趣

智能優(yōu)化方法及其在人工智能和控制論中的應(yīng)用,包括

  • 演化學(xué)習(xí)方法:機(jī)器學(xué)習(xí)、聯(lián)邦學(xué)習(xí)、數(shù)據(jù)挖掘的演化計(jì)算求解方法
  • 人工智能的底層優(yōu)化問題:同步/異步并行優(yōu)化、面向大數(shù)據(jù)的隨機(jī)優(yōu)化、流形優(yōu)化、多目標(biāo)/多層次優(yōu)化等
  • 智能控制方法:演化多智能體系統(tǒng)、強(qiáng)化學(xué)習(xí)的黑盒策略搜索

科研項(xiàng)目

  • 2021-2023, 國家自然科學(xué)基金青年項(xiàng)目,面向大規(guī)模黑盒優(yōu)化的協(xié)方差矩陣適應(yīng)演化策略,主持
  • 2021-2023, 廣東省自然科學(xué)基金面上項(xiàng)目,面向聯(lián)邦學(xué)習(xí)的信息幾何優(yōu)化方法,主持
  • 2020-2021, 廣東省基礎(chǔ)與應(yīng)用基礎(chǔ)科學(xué)基金青年項(xiàng)目,基于混合模型的大規(guī)模演化策略研究,主持
  • 2019-2021, 中國博士后科學(xué)基金面上項(xiàng)目,面向復(fù)雜決策空間的演化多目標(biāo)優(yōu)化,主持
